Course Overview

The Bachelor of Science in Entrepreneurship at Wilson College empowers you to forge your own path in the business world, ideal for those with a keen interest in management, finance, and innovation. In a global economy where business complexity and regulatory landscapes are ever-evolving, this degree equips you with the essential skills to navigate challenges and seize opportunities. You will delve into critical areas such as financial accounting, business law, strategic management, and entrepreneurial business planning, preparing you to make informed, flexible decisions in dynamic markets. This program is designed for ambitious individuals ready to lead and innovate.

You will study this undergraduate degree full-time on campus over four years, engaging with a robust curriculum that includes core business principles and specialized entrepreneurship courses. Your learning experience will involve developing comprehensive business plans, analysing case studies, and potentially undertaking internships to gain practical experience. The syllabus emphasizes practical application, ensuring you develop a strong foundation in areas like managerial accounting and entrepreneurial innovation. You will graduate with a Bachelor of Science degree, ready to pursue careers in small business management, startup creation, or broader business development roles.

Program Overview

The Bachelor of Science in Entrepreneurship program equips students with the foundational knowledge and practical skills necessary to launch and manage successful ventures. This comprehensive curriculum covers essential business disciplines including financial and managerial accounting, economics, business law, and strategic management. Students will delve into the intricacies of entrepreneurial innovation, develop robust business plans, and gain real-world experience through internships, preparing them for the dynamic challenges of the business world.

1 Required Courses

Financial Accounting
Managerial Accounting
Taxes I
Introduction to Management
Business Communications
Entrepreneurship/Small Business Managemt
Business Law
Business Environment and Public Policy
International Business
Internship
Entrepreneurial Business Plans
Entrepreneurial Innovation Mgt
Case Studies - Entrepreneurshp
Strategic Management
Intro to Macroeconomics
Intro to Microeconomics
Corporate Finance Fundamentals
College Algebra
Introductory Statistics
Business Ethics

Can I work while studying?

International students can work up to 20 hours per week during term time and full-time during breaks in the U.S. No separate work permit is needed for on-campus jobs.

What English language score do I need for this course?

To enroll, you'll need to meet specific English language requirements. This includes scores from tests like Duolingo (overall score: 95) or TOEFL (overall score: 61).
